Impact of Temperature on Roof Installation



When it pertains to roofing system setup, temperature plays a crucial function while doing so. The ideal temperature level for roof tasks usually falls between 45 and 85 levels Fahrenheit. Severe warmth can create products like roof shingles to end up being too flexible, bring about prospective damages during setup. On the other hand, cool temperatures can make products brittle and susceptible to fracturing. It's important to set up roofing setups during moderate temperatures to make certain the best outcome.

During colder climate, professionals may require to take extra safety measures such as utilizing warmed tools or allowing materials to warm up prior to setup.

In contrast, heat may call for job to be done previously or later in the day to avoid the peak temperatures. By considering the temperature level and its effects on roof covering products, you can help ensure an effective setup that will hold up against the aspects for many years ahead.
